Ext4 is the fourth generation of the ext file system family and it can read and write to ext2 or ext3 file systems, but the ext4 filesystem format is not compatible with ext2 and ext3 drivers. Ext3 was mostly about adding journaling to ext2, but ext4 modifies important data structures of the filesystem such as the ones destined to store the file data. According to an ars technica article, the reason that android switched to ext4 from yaffs2 for its file system is because yaffs2 is singlethreaded, and would likely have been a bottleneck on dualcore systems. The ext4 journaling file system or fourth extended filesystem is a journaling file system for linux, developed as the successor to ext3 ext4 was initially a series of backwardcompatible extensions to ext3, many of them originally developed by cluster file systems for the lustre file system between 2003 and 2006, meant to extend storage limits and add other performance.
